Definition
Allegory is a story in which the characters and events are symbols that stand for ideas about humans life or for a political or historical situation.
Facts
Examples -
1." Faerie Queene" by Edmund Spenser is a religious or moral allegory where characters represent virtues and vices.
2."Animal Farm" by George Orwell is a political allegory of events in Russia and Communism.
